Re: My Battery Life has gone from 15+ hours to 5 in one day

Check out my thread just above yours, "I think I fixed my battery drain".

Make sure your contact list is backed up. Go ino Settings/Apps/All. Find your Contacts app (and if you want to be thorough, any of the other apps with contacts in the title. Delete cache, information, etc from those apps.

Reboot phone. ReSync Contact list.

See if that helps.

I suspect that there also might be a problem with the recent Google Search update. Did you update it or use google search/OK Google recently?

Re: My Battery Life has gone from 15+ hours to 5 in one day

Agreed with this. Charging at 40/50%? So we only use half of our battery? Seems unrealistic. Truth is, You shouldn't ever let your battery fully discharge, that could however cause problems, but not a software one. 57% usage in 3 hours is the problem.

Not sure if you are rooted or not, But if you are.. you may want to check out Wakelock Detector to see what that imposing app is.. or If you are not you may be able to get a better idea with GSAM Battery monitor, generally that app will give you a little more information.
